Zen Educate is seeking an experienced Data Manager to join the administrative team in St Helens. The ideal candidate will provide management support during a period of change, maintaining accurate data systems and ensuring compliance with GDPR.
Key responsibilities include:
- Overseeing data management systems
- Producing reports to assist decision-making
The role requires proven data management experience and strong organisational skills within an educational environment.
